Recognizing Otolaryngology: A Review



Otolaryngology, usually referred to as ENT (Nose, ear, and throat) medication, is a specific branch of medication that concentrates on the medical diagnosis and therapy of problems impacting these crucial areas of the human body. This area incorporates a variety of disorders, including those related to hearing, equilibrium, respiratory system function, and speech. Otolaryngologists are educated to handle both medical and medical treatments, utilizing sophisticated methods and modern technologies. Their knowledge prolongs beyond standard ailments, dealing with problems such as allergic reactions, sinus infections, and hearing loss. Furthermore, they play a vital duty in the monitoring of head and neck cancers cells, giving complete treatment tailored to specific patient requirements. In general, otolaryngology continues to be important for keeping wellness and lifestyle in afflicted individuals.




Usual Factors to See an ENT Specialist





Several individuals seek the knowledge of an ENT expert for a range of reasons, showing the varied nature of conditions that impact the nose, throat, and ear. Usual problems include persistent sinusitis, which typically leads to consistent nasal congestion and face pain. Allergic reactions and their connected symptoms, such as sneezing and itching, additionally prompt visits to these specialists (Sinus). Hearing loss, whether gradual or abrupt, is one more considerable factor for examination. Additionally, people may look for evaluation for throat problems, consisting of relentless hoarseness or swallowing difficulties. Sleep apnea, defined by interrupted breathing during sleep, is frequently dealt with by ENT specialists as well. Each of these conditions highlights the value of specialized care in taking care of complicated ENT-related health concerns

Diagnostic Examinations and Treatments in Otolaryngology



A variety of diagnostic examinations and procedures are essential in otolaryngology to properly assess and detect problems affecting the nose, ear, and throat. Usual tests include audiometry, which gauges hearing function, and tympanometry, analyzing center ear pressure. Nasal endoscopy permits visualization of the nasal passages and sinuses, while laryngoscopy analyzes the throat and vocal cables. Imaging strategies, such as CT scans and MRIs, supply comprehensive sights of head and neck frameworks. Allergic reaction testing might additionally be conducted to recognize triggers for sinus or respiratory system issues. These diagnostic tools allow ENT experts to develop a thorough understanding of individuals' problems, making sure tailored and efficient management plans. Proper diagnosis is important for successful treatment results in otolaryngology.


Treatment Choices Supplied by ENT Specialists



ENT specialists supply a selection of therapy alternatives customized to address details problems impacting the nose, throat, and ear. These therapies range from traditional methods, such as medicine and way of life alterations, to more invasive treatments. Allergic reactions might be handled with antihistamines or immunotherapy, while chronic sinus problems might need nasal corticosteroids or sinus surgical treatment. For hearing loss, ENT professionals commonly recommend hearing help or surgical interventions like cochlear implants. In instances of throat conditions, options can consist of speech therapy or medical treatments to remove blockages. Additionally, they may offer support for taking care of rest apnea, including the usage of CPAP tools or medical treatments.
